Job Summary
The role involves assisting the Director of Staff Development (DSD) in organizing employee orientation and in-service education programs according to facility policies.
Employees must maintain complete department records, schedule safety drills, and manage inventory for supplies while ensuring HIPAA compliance.
This position requires strong clerical skills, computer literacy, and the ability to coordinate health examinations and incident documentation.

Skills & Requirements
Must-have
High school diploma or GED required
Exceptional communication skills needed
Computer literacy and office equipment knowledge
Ability to read and interpret regulations
Knowledge of clerical functions essential
Nice-to-have
Courteous and cooperative communication style
Good working rapport with inter-department personnel
